Fusion bomb, also known as a thermonuclear bomb or hydrogen bomb, is a powerful and destructive weapon that utilizes nuclear fusion reactions to release an enormous amount of energy. All the parts of speech in English are used to make sentences. All sentences include two parts: the subject and the verb (this is also known as the predicate). The subject is the person or thing that does something or that is described in the sentence. The verb is the action the person or thing takes or the description of the person or thing. If a sentence doesn’t have a subject and a verb, it is not a complete sentence (e.g., In the sentence “Went to bed,” we don’t know who went to bed).
